1. A compact sensor system for measuring at least one component of a small electric field generated by an object comprising:

  • a first, capacitive-type electrical sensor adapted to generate first electric potential signals related to the electric field at a first position spaced from the object;

    a second electrical sensor located at a second position which is spaced a predetermined, fixed distance from said first position and does not depend on the object generating the small electric field, said second electrical sensor being adapted to generate second electric potential signals related to the electric field; and

    a controller for processing the first and second electric potential signals to determine a first vector component, having both a magnitude and a direction, of the electric field.
